I have been in Chittenango for two weeks now. So I have two weeks of experience that I can speak from! When you come from another country, the first things you notice are the differences from home. A big difference is the food. In Europe, well at least in the countries I have been to, we don’t have as many fast food restaurants as the US has. So the first thing I did was try out all the different fast food restaurants. I tried Chick-fil-A and Chipotle… and it was great! Another huge difference is sports. In Germany nobody plays a sport at school. If we want to do a sport, we go to clubs or schools after our school day ends. I really enjoy doing cheer here in the afternoon and having people around me that also attend Chittenango.
